> Markdown: Generated anchors of headings are incompatible with "regular"
> inpage-links
> ------------------------------------------------------------------------------------
>
> Key: DOXIA-771
> URL: https://issues.apache.org/jira/browse/DOXIA-771
> Project: Maven Doxia
> Issue Type: Bug
> Affects Versions: 2.0.0-M12
> Reporter: Matthias Bünger
> Priority: Major
>
> (Disclaimer: I'm not sure if the issue is right here of must be placed in
> Doxiasitetools, please move it, if wrong).
> -----
> I updated a page of the Maven-Site (so I think affected version is latest
> 2.0.0-M12) and wanted to create links to section headings on the same page.
> The "regular" way according to Google is that anchors are generated with all
> lowercase, minus between words and removed special chars.
> So you can create a link like this
> {code}
> ### How do I skip unit tests when building a project?
> Create a [link to that](how-do-i-skip-unit-tests-when-building-a-project)
> {code}
> The IDE (IntelliJ) is happy with that (meaning shows no warning, that the
> anchor may not exist), but the link does not work, because DOXIA generates
> another anchor
> {code}
> <a id="How_do_I_skip_unit_tests_when_building_a_project.3F"></a>
> {code}
> Which results, that you (I did not find another way) you have to create the
> link using exactly this generated anchor
> {code}
> ### How do I skip unit tests when building a project?
> Create a [link to that](#How_do_I_skip_unit_tests_when_building_a_project.3F)
> {code}
> Which is not very intuitiv to write.
> Note:
> I also tried to manually create and use an anchor, e.g.
> {code}
> <a id="HowDoISkipUnitTests"></a>
> ### How do I skip unit tests when building a project?
> Create a [link to that](#HowDoISkipUnitTests)
> {code}
> But this manual defined anchor got totally ignored and not generated in the
> resulting HTML.
